    here is the current Allocation Order (before the Danny Califf to Philly Union deal b/c I’m not sure how that is handled)…
    1. Colorado Rapids
    2. Kansas City Wizards
    3. Chivas USA
    4. New England Revolution
    5. Toronto FC
    6. Real Salt Lake
    7. Chicago Fire
    8. New York Red Bulls
    9. Columbus Crew
    10. Seattle Sounders FC (Kasey Keller)
    11. Houston Dynamo (Felix Garcia)
    12. San Jose Earthquakes (Bobby Convey)
    13. LA Galaxy (Gregg Berhalter)
    14. DC United (Danny Szetela)
    15. FC Dallas (Heath Pearce)

    We could talk about the following things:
    1) Revising the official club name to Sounders FC b/c Seattle Sounders FC is too long, too arduous, too much of a mouth full and we’ll be just as easily identified by Sounders FC. It’s like Arsenal…where the f*ck are they from? It’s not that hard.  
    2) Open the Hawk’s Nest b/c there needs to be a more inexpensive season ticket option as well as a good matchday walk-up option for general spectators as well as certain groups, such as Latinos. It’s great that the FO has opened up more season tickets, but look at the cost of those seats. Doesn’t it make sense to let those who are curious about the Sounders walk up and buy some tickets and experience the passion and momentum for themselves? Most of them will convert. And other clubs are starting to achieve traction with groups such as Latinos b/c, while they might not buy season tickets, there is the opportunity to at least get them in the stadium and allow them to a) connect with the team, b) begin to support the team in the fun and unique ways they know and understand.

    There are more…this is a start.  

    jt Reply:

    As to #2 – drop it.  Not going to happen.  Microsoft pays a LOT of money to have their signage up there, more than anyone is willing to pay for a season ticket.  As for gameday availability, there is a point when things sell out.  It’s called supply and demand, and there is nothing the FO can do on it.

    Opening up seats that may or may not sell isn’t in their interest or the interest of the existing season ticket holders.  Want to get someone interested without committing 4 months out?  Take them to the march to the match, and watch the game in one of the bars there in Pioneer Square.

    Rumor is that the march is going from 90 minutes before kick to 60 minutes.  Hopefully they will match up the gates opening to that as well.
